Latest Patents

One of her latest patents is titled "System and method for creating and displaying optional order sets in healthcare environment." This invention provides a method, system, and computerized medium for placing optional orders for an order set for a patient. The system receives a request to display an order set, which comprises one or more optional orders. The optional orders are determined and displayed, allowing for a selection of one or more to be placed for the order set.

Another significant patent is the "Computerized system and method for building a system of test components for a healthcare orderable procedure." This invention involves receiving an orderable healthcare procedure and associating it with a discrete ontology concept. The system traverses an ontology to identify test components related to the discrete ontology concept, enhancing the efficiency of healthcare procedures.
